M/s Digital Studio bought a machine for `Rs.` 8,00,000 on April 01,2013 . Depreciation was provided on straight-line basis at the rate of `20%` on original cost. On April 01, 2015 a substantial modification was made in the machine to make it more efficient at a cost of `Rs.` 80,000. This amount is to be depreciated @ 20% on straight line basis. Routine maintenance expenses during the year 2013-14 were `Rs.` 2,000
Draw up the Machine account, Provision for depreciation account and charge to profit and loss account in respect of the accounting year ended on March 31, 2016.

Working Notes
(1) Cost of modification is capitalised but routine repair expenses are treated as revenue expenditure
2. Calculation of balance of provision for depreciation account on 01.04.2014. Original Cost on 01.04.2013` " " =Rs. 8,00,000`
Depreciation for the years 2013-14 and 2014-15 `" " =Rs. 3,20,000^(1)`
` ("@"% "of" Rs. 8,00,000)`
(3) Depreciation for the year 2015-16 is calculated as under:
`20% "of" 8,00,000 " " =Rs. 1,60,000`
`20% "of" Rs. 80,000" " =underline Rs. 16,000`
Total Depreciation for 2015-16 `" " =Rs.1,76,000^(2)`
(4) Amount to be charged to profit and loss account
Depreciation `" " Rs. 1,76,000^(2)`
Repair and maintencance `" " Rs. 2,000`
